2. Adobe Express Background Remover
Adobe is the undisputed king of creative software, and their free web tool, Adobe Express Background Remover, brings a lot of that Photoshop magic straight into your browser.
Because it uses Adobe Sensei AI, the cutout quality is incredibly industrial-grade. It's especially great if you plan to do further editing, because once the background is gone, you can immediately open the image inside the free Adobe Express editor to add text, shapes, or filters.
The Catch: You do need to sign up for a free Adobe account to download your image, which adds an extra step to the process.
Best For: Designers who want a highly accurate cut and intend to keep editing the image right inside a design platform.

3. Photoroom
If you are running an online storefront on eBay, Etsy, or Shopify, Photoroom is an absolute lifesaver.
Photoroom isn't just about making a background transparent; it’s about replacing it with something better. Once the AI strips out your original background, it offers a ton of free studio-lighting presets, solid color backdrops, and artificial shadows to make your product look like it was shot in a professional studio.
The Catch: The free web tier puts a tiny Photoroom watermark in the corner of your downloaded image. It’s small enough to crop out for most casual uses, but worth keeping in mind.
Best For: E-commerce sellers and resellers looking to quickly create clean, professional product listings.
4. remove.bg
You can't talk about background removal without mentioning remove.bg. They are one of the absolute pioneers in this space and have been a staple bookmarked tool for millions of internet users for years.
The speed of remove.bg is unmatched—it takes maybe a single second from upload to output. Their AI is mature and rarely makes mistakes on standard portraits or product shots.
The Catch: Their free tier is heavily restricted on resolution. It lets you download unlimited standard-quality preview images for free, but if you want the full, uncompressed high-res HD file, they try to nudge you toward their paid credit system.
Best For: Fast, casual web-resolution graphics, avatars, and quick digital layouts.

5. PhotoRoom AI by Photopea
For those who want absolute, granular control, Photopea (the famous free web-based Photoshop alternative) has integrated its own automated background removal tools.
By opening your image in Photopea and using their automated select tool, you get the best of both worlds: the AI does 95% of the heavy lifting, but you have access to a full suite of brushes, masks, and layers to manually fix any tiny mistakes the AI might have made on tricky borders.
The Catch: The interface is literally a clone of Photoshop, so it can feel a bit overwhelming if you aren't familiar with traditional graphic design software.
Best For: Power users and advanced hobbyists who want total control over the extraction process.
